Ceremony Details

Awards Ceremony Date/Time: Sunday, February 27, 2011, 5:30pm
Location: Kodak Theatre at Hollywood & Highland
Televised On: ABC
Host: James Franco, Anne Hathaway
Length: 3 hours, 15 minutes
Nielsen Ratings: 21.20 rating
Viewers: 37.90 million

Previous Acting & Directing Winners

The tradition of prior acting winners returning the subsequent year to present the opposite-gender category is a long one. Each year, we look to see whether the prior winners returned. There was an intermittent tradition where the prior directing winner returned as well, but this was a rare occurrence.

Actor – Jeff Bridges: Yes
Actress – Sandra Bullock: Yes
Supporting Actor – Christoph Waltz: No
Supporting Actress – Mo’Nique: No
Directing – Kathryn Bigelow: Yes

Original Song Film Performers

Was the song performed at the Oscars by the same individuals who performed it in the film?

Coming Home: No (Performed in the Film by: Leighton Meester)
I See the Light: Partial (Mandy Moore & Zachary Levi only) (Performed in the Film by: Mandy Moore, Zachary Levi)
If I Rise: Partial (A.R. Rahman only) (Performed in the Film by: Dido, A.R. Rahman)
We Belong Together: Yes (Performed in the Film by: Randy Newman)
